IMPROVEMENTS IN OR RELATING TO LIQUID MODERATOR NUCLEAR REACTORS SUBJECT TO VARYING MOVEMENTS

Patent ·
OSTI ID:4674749
A method for reducing irregularities in the operation of a liquid- moderated reactor subject to varying movements, such as those encountered on a ship, is patented. A flowcontrol device in the moderator circuit regulates the delivery of the moderator to the reactor to compensate for variation in the density of the moderator liquid in the reactor vessel due to acceleration of the vessel. The flow-control device increases the moderator flow when the density decreases, and decreases flow when the density increases. Regulation may be effected by a mass, which is displaceable by acceleration and varies the flow cross-section of the recycled liquid. Various designs for the flow-control device are described.
